The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S) scores providers 0–100 across four performance categories: Quality, Cost, Promoting Interoperability, and Improvement Activities, weighted under 42 CFR §414.1380. Reporting is voluntary for many small practices, so absence of a MIPS score is not a quality signal.

IBRAHIM ABDALLA, M.D. appears in the CMS NPPES registry as a Specialist provider holding M.D. credentials at 3850 S NATIONAL AVE, SPRINGFIELD, MO, 65807, with a listed phone of (417) 269-8926. NPI 1437154630 was issued on 06/15/2005. Because NPPES data is self-reported by the provider and refreshed monthly, the address, phone, and specialty reflect what ABDALLA most recently submitted to CMS rather than a vetted directory listing, which is why patients should always confirm the practice is still at this location before scheduling.

Medicare Part D records for calendar year 2023 show 439 prescription claims written by this provider, covering 157 Medicare beneficiaries and totaling roughly $9K in drug spend, with an opioid prescribing rate of 12.1%. These figures capture only Medicare Part D — commercial insurance, Medicaid, and cash-pay prescriptions are not included, and any drug-beneficiary cell under 11 is suppressed by CMS for patient privacy. On the CMS Merit-based Incentive Payment System, this provider earned a Final Score of 75/100 for the 2023 performance year, compared with the national average of 83.1.

Specialist is a high-volume specialty nationwide, with 69,658 enrolled providers across 55 states and an average of 1,474 Part D claims per prescriber, so the context for interpreting these metrics differs meaningfully from a primary-care baseline. Data Sources

Provider Directory
CMS National Plan and Provider Enumeration System (NPPES), download.cms.gov/nppes, updated monthly. Contains NPI, specialty, credentials, and practice location.
Specialty Classification
N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y (nucc.org), the industry standard for classifying provider specialties in Medicare and Medicaid billing.
Prescribing Data
CMS Medicare Part D Prescriber Public Use File (2023). Includes claims, drug costs, beneficiaries, and opioid prescribing rates.
Quality Performance
CMS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S) — 2023 performance year.
Limitations
Provider data is self-reported to CMS. Prescribing data reflects Medicare Part D only and does not include commercial insurance, Medicaid, or cash prescriptions. Claims below 11 beneficiaries are suppressed by CMS for privacy.
